    Do Smart Thermostats Need Wi-Fi?

    While smart thermostats offer advanced features when connected to Wi-Fi, they can still function without it. Without Wi-Fi, smart thermostats can typically perform basic functions like temperature adjustments manually or through the device’s interface. You may miss out on remote access and some advanced features that require an internet connection, but the core functionality remains intact.

    Alternatives for Smart Thermostats Without WiFi

    If your home lacks a WiFi connection or you prefer a smart thermostat that doesn’t rely on WiFi, there are still viable options available that can efficiently regulate your indoor temperature. Consider the following alternatives:

    1. Non-WiFi Enabled Smart Thermostats

    Opt for smart thermostats that operate independently of WiFi, utilizing other communication protocols like Zigbee or Z-Wave. These thermostats can still offer advanced features such as scheduling, temperature adjustments, and energy-saving modes without the need for a WiFi connection.

    Real-Time Monitoring and Alerts

    By connecting to WiFi, your smart thermostat can provide real-time updates on your home’s temperature and energy usage. It can also send alerts and notifications regarding maintenance needs or abnormal temperature fluctuations, keeping you informed and in control.
